300-pound bull wanders onto Jurupa Valley High School campus

Deputies with the Riverside County Sheriff’s Department responded quickly this morning when an unexpected visitor showed up at Jurupa Valley High School – a full-grown 300-pound bull.

Jurupa Valley sheriff’s officials say the bull wandered onto the high school grounds, prompting a coordinated response from deputies, animal control officers and local handlers. Using calm, careful tactics – and a lasso – officers and deputies were able to safely wrangle the animal without incident.

There were no injuries reported to students, school staff, deputies or the bull during the event…
